The University of Strathclyde Business School in Glasgow, Scotland, is officially accepting applications for the 2026 Stephen Young Global Leaders’ Scholarship Programme (SYGL). This highly prestigious, fully funded scholarship program was established following a monumental £50 million donation from distinguished university alumnus Dr. Charles Huang through his philanthropic foundation.

The award honors his late PhD mentor, Professor Stephen Young, and is designed to develop globally minded, exceptional future executives capable of driving sustainable, responsible business growth.
Benefits of the Scholarship
The SYGL program goes far beyond standard financial aid, acting as an elite incubator for global corporate leaders:
- Full payment of tuition fees for the full-time MBA or MSc degree.
- Periodic payments to fully support living expenses in Glasgow throughout the academic year.
- One-on-one professional coaching from an active corporate leader, CEO, or senior industry executive tailored to your long-term career goals.
- Scholars can apply for one of three fully funded experiential tracks:
- Attend an international MBA elective class at Strathclyde’s overseas hubs (Europe, the Middle East, or Asia), including flights and lodging.
- Complete an international summer school placement at a partner global university.
- Participate in a signature research initiative organized by the Stephen Young Institute for International Business.

Available Courses
The scholarship supports up to five outstanding candidates enrolling in a full-time, one-year Master of Business Administration (MBA) or Master of Science (MSc) program within the following Business School disciplines:
- Accounting and Finance
- Business and Management
- Data Analytics
- Economics
- Entrepreneurship
- Marketing
- Management Science
Eligibility Criteria
To be considered for this elite award, candidates must meet the following structural requirements:
- Demonstrate exceptional academic performance, holding a First-Class Honours undergraduate degree from a UK university, or the verified international equivalent from a recognized institution.
- Must be a self-funded student. Candidates with access to external corporate sponsorships or alternative major scholarship funds are excluded.
- Meet the core entry criteria for your target full-time postgraduate program at Strathclyde.
- Shortlisted finalists must be available to attend a rigorous formal panel interview (conducted either virtually or in person).
